Herpes 2 Transmission

I went to a amateur baseball tournament a week and used the same bar of soap and the same towel as someone who has genital herpes. I was under the assumption that a person cannot get herpes simplex 2 unless you are engaged in sexual activities but a buddy of mine disagrees. I'm extremely worried! What is the truth? Thanks.

Your buddy is wrong.  Herpes is transmitted by person to person contact, not indirectly and absolutely not by a bar of soap. The soap would have inactivated any virus that it came in contact with.  You have nothing to worry about. EWH
